    So the `+` is not _overloaded_, the `+` syntax is a shorthand for calling a method named `__add__` on the value of the first operand, with the value of the second operand as an argument . That is: `e1 + e2` is syntactic sugar for `e1.__add__(e2)`, no more and no less.

    It's not "operator overloading" any more than two _different_ classes having a `length` property is "length overloading".

    Using the term "operator overloading" to begin with is the error here.

      If + silently gets translated to adding 2 numbers or joining 2 strings that is operator overloading, no matter how it's done under the hood.

      If python had you write e1.__add__(e2) Or S1.__join__(s2)

      Then you would have 2 distinct operators, therefore no overloading.

      Re classes.

      Foo.len() and bar.len() are different. You can tell that when you are using them.

      It's no different to I_add() and f_add() they are both different functions.

      If you automatically called one of those depending on whether the arguments were floats or ints, that would be overloading.

      I suppose you could take it further and say that it's overloading if you have different int sizes.

      But then we don't really class that as overloading, which I suppose demonstrates that it isn't a very precise term so there isn't much point getting particularly pedantic about it.

      Agda has the most wonderful (terrifying?) operator syntax I know of. Any Unicode (except for a few reserved words) can be used, and you can indicate where operandi go with an underscore. For instance defining a function named _•_ would allow you to use a • b.

      But there is no limit to where the underscores go: the name _? Would give you x ? postfix. To define if-statements one defines the name if_then_else_.
